Wastewater discharge reported
Tuesday, June 25, 2024 12:05 am
Hawaii County on Sunday reported an estimated 607,000 gallons of “nonchlorinated secondary treated effluent” was discharged Friday from the Hilo Wastewater Treatment Plant between 8:15 a.m. and 12:30 p.m.
The cause of the failure was determined to have occurred when the chlorine was being replenished, according to the county.
Restoration of the system was completed at approximately 12:30 p.m.
The state Department of Health was notified, and it issued a water quality advisory for Hilo Bay outside of the Hilo breakwater.
